RF dielectric filters are designed and made by using dielectric ceramic materials with low loss, high dielectric constant, small frequency temperature coefficient and thermal expansion coefficient, and can withstand high power and other characteristics. Mainly used in high-frequency operation of electronic equipment, for greater attenuation of high-frequency electronic equipment generated by high-frequency interference signals.
